Instructions
1. In a large pot, bring the chicken broth to a boil.
2. Add the soy sauce, sesame oil, garlic, and ginger. Let it simmer for 5 minutes.
3. Add the chicken breast slices and cook until they are no longer pink, about 10 minutes.
4. In a separate pot, cook the ramen noodles according to the package instructions. Drain and set aside.
5. Add the baby spinach to the broth and cook until wilted, about 2 minutes.
6. Divide the cooked noodles into bowls. Pour the broth and chicken over the noodles.
7. Top each bowl with halved boiled eggs and sliced green onions. Serve hot.
